Sentence in beating death of Hawks' player's father

By
CHICAGO - A 37-year-old Chicago man has been sentenced to 42 years in prison in the beating death of the father of Atlanta Hawks player Nazr Mohammed. <br> <br> In July 2000, 55-year-old Alhaji Mohammed was found dead at his auto parts store on Chicago&#39;s South Side. Prosecutors say Walter Hughes beat Mohammed to death in a dispute over money. A Cook County jury convicted Hughes of first-degree murder and armed robbery in April. <br> <br> Cook County Judge Stanley Sacks sentenced Hughes Thursday to 42 years for Mohammed&#39;s murder and ten years for the armed robbery. The sentences will run concurrently. <br> <br> The victim&#39;s son, Nazr Mohammed, played for the Philadelphia 76ers before being traded to the Hawks in 2001.
